If the associated Trusted application is supported on the secure part, this driver offers a client interface to load firmware by the secure part. This firmware could be authenticated by the secure trusted application. A specificity of the implementation is that the firmware has to be authenticated and optionally decrypted to access the resource table. Consequently, the boot sequence is: 1) rproc_parse_fw --> rproc_tee_parse_fw remoteproc TEE: - Requests the TEE application to authenticate and load the firmware in the remote processor memories. - Requests the TEE application for the address of the resource table. - Creates a copy of the resource table stored in rproc->cached_table. 2) rproc_load_segments --> rproc_tee_load_fw remoteproc TEE: - Requests the TEE application to load the firmware. Nothing is done at the TEE application as the firmware is already loaded. - In case of recovery, the TEE application has to reload the firmware. 3) rproc_tee_get_loaded_rsc_table remoteproc TEE requests the TEE application for the address of the resource table. 4) rproc_start --> rproc_tee_start - Requests the TEE application to start the remote processor. The shutdown sequence is: 5) rproc_stop --> rproc_tee_stop - Requests the TEE application to stop the remote processor. 6) rproc_tee_release_fw This function is used to request the TEE application to perform actions to return to the initial state on stop or on error during the boot sequence.
